Soroptimist International of Raleigh, NC meets the second Tuesday of most months (September to May), at Hudson Memorial Presbyterian Church, 4921 Six Forks Road (between Lassiter Mill Road and Millbrook Road). Most meetings are open to guests.

The 2008 - 2009 club year offered meetings on the themes of ending violence against women, human trafficking awareness, women's health issues, international project opportunities, and economic independence for women.

The May 2009 meeting featured Katy Hyde, associated with Duke, discussing challenges faced by women of other cultures.

At our February 2007 meeting our focus was on women's health and cervical cancer. Dr. Pouru Bhiwandi, professor of maternal child health at University of North Carolina and former medical director of Family Health International was our distinguished speaker.

In January 2007, our focus was on our professional clothing closet, and two of our Referring Partners discussed us how our clothing closet enhances their own programs. Speakers included Gina Lipscomb, of Jubilee Jobs, and Valerie Fairley of CasaWorks.

In November 2006, our focus was Human Rights. Our speaker was Behjat Dehghan, of the Association of International Women for Human Rights. Ms. Beth Dehghan, a long-time women's rights activist from Iran, is the founder and president of the Association of International Women for Human Rights and an active lobbyist in the UN General Assembly and the Human Rights Commission. She provided a fascinating glimpse of what's going on with Human Rights around the world.
